Expand


\sum ^6_(n\mathop=1)(1-n)\text{ indicates that we w}ill\text{ substitute values of n from 1 to 6 and find their sum}

Substitute when n=1

We will have that (1-n)


\begin{gathered} (1-n)=(1-1)=0 \\ \text{when n= 2} \\ (1-n)=(1-2)=-1 \\ \text{when n=3} \\ (1-n)=(1-3)=-2 \\ \text{when n=4} \\ (1-n)=(1-4)=-3 \\ \text{when n=5} \\ (1-n)=(1-5)=-4 \\ \text{when n=6} \\ (1-n)=(1-6)=-5 \end{gathered}

Therefore,


\begin{gathered} \sum ^6_(n\mathop=1)(1-n)= \\ =0+(-1)+(-2)+(-3)+(-4)+(-5) \end{gathered}

Hence,

The correct option would be the first option A
